In the realm of advanced biochemical research and cellular immunology, the reliability of experimental controls is paramount. My recent experience with the GenScript control peptide pool—specifically their standard CEF (Cytomegalovirus, Epstein-Barr virus, and Influenza virus) reference products—has provided significant insights into the necessity of high-purity, well-characterized reagents for standardization.
The GenScript control peptide pool often refers to a standardized assembly of 32 peptides, typically ranging from 8 to 12 amino acids in length. These are derived from highly conserved epitopes of human viruses, including CMV, EBV, and Influenza. When I look at the Genscript catalog peptide options, it is clear why this specific pool is a staple for laboratory workflows; it serves as a critical positive control to ensure that assays are functioning within specified parameters.
